Who Is Liable For Uber Accidents In Glenn County?
Identifying the negligent party or parties is just the first step. You also need to determine and prove the nature of their negligence, in addition to several other circumstances.
Multiple parties may share liability in rideshare accidents, including:
- Uber — Uber, the corporate entity itself, could be responsible for an accident in certain situations. One example is when the company is negligent in its hiring or training of drivers. The same is true if a defect in their software or technology leads to an accident.
- The Uber Driver — If the Uber driver is mainly at fault for the accident, they may be accountable for any damages. It is important to note that Uber offers insurance for its many driver-partners. This insurance policy protects against both bodily and property damage caused by its drivers. Our Uber accident attorneys in Glenn County will help you navigate such intricacies.
- Third-Party Driver — If another driver is at fault for the accident, their insurance would usually pay for the damages. However, Uber also offers additional coverage in case the other driver’s insurance is insufficient to pay the damages.
- Local Government — In California, government organizations may be held responsible in such situations where an unsafe public road or highway condition led to an accident.

Common Causes Of Uber Accidents In Glenn County
As with any vehicular accident, Uber crashes can be caused by a number of factors. Some of the most common reasons for Uber accidents are:
Exceeding The Speed Limit
Rideshare drivers may exceed the speed limit to transport their passengers more quickly. Doing so also maximizes their earnings by picking up additional customers. However, driving at excessive speeds can result in severe accidents, causing injuries.
Distracted Driving
Using GPS, talking through their cell phones, and chatting with their passengers excessively are some of the risky distracted driving behaviors Uber drivers can exhibit that can contribute to rideshare accidents.
Seeking Individuals To Ride Along
When drivers for rideshare services are searching for a passenger, they may pay insufficient attention to other cars on the road. Furthermore, they could unexpectedly stop or change direction without warning. Doing these things can result in a crash.
Poor Vehicle Maintenance
If a rideshare driver fails to maintain their vehicle properly, the brakes, tires, or other components may malfunction. This could then result in them losing control of their vehicle while on the road. Our Glenn County Uber accident attorneys will thoroughly investigate these factors in your personal injury case.
Driving While Fatigued
Individuals employed by Uber have the flexibility to determine their working hours. Also, they may have another occupation on the side. If they spend extended periods driving because they have two jobs, they can experience greater weariness while driving. In fact, doing so is equally as hazardous as driving under the influence.
Driving While Intoxicated
If a driver is under the influence of drugs or alcohol, their ability to react, make judgments, see, and perform other essential driving abilities will be affected. They have a higher chance of causing an Uber accident. This is because they may drive fast, change lanes frequently, and fail to follow fundamental traffic rules.

The coverage amount of the said insurance depends on the specifics of the Uber accident. Here are the four periods covered by Uber’s insurance:
- Period Zero — If the Uber app is not active and the driver is not accepting trips at the time of the accident, Uber’s insurance policy will not apply. Instead, the driver’s own policy will cover the victim’s damages.
- Period One — When the app is on and the driver is waiting for a trip request, Uber may provide $50,000 in coverage for bodily injury per person, $25,000 for property damage, or $100,000 per accident.
- Period Two — If the driver accepts a trip request or is on their way to pick up a passenger, the insurance coverage jumps to $1 million. Furthermore, Uber provides $1 million of coverage for riders who are uninsured or underinsured.
- Period Three — This period of Uber insurance begins as soon as the driver collects a passenger via the app. It has the identical coverage mentioned in Period Two.

Economic damages are measurable and tangible losses that can be calculated through receipts and invoices, among others. Examples include:
- Medical Bills (Medications, Surgeries, Rehabilitation, etc.)
- Lost Wages
- Reduced Income
- Property Damage
- Physical Injuries (Disabilities or Disfigurements)
Non-economic damages are intangible losses that are subjective in nature and, thus, harder to calculate. They include:
- Pain And Suffering
- Inconvenience
- Mental Distress And Anguish
- Lower Quality Of Life
- Loss Of Consortium
It is worth mentioning that the court only awards punitive damages when it determines that the actions of the party responsible were grossly negligent or malicious. It is aimed at punishing the defendant and helping prevent similar behavior in the future rather than directly compensating the victim. However, just a handful of cases result in punitive damages being awarded as compensation.

Will My Uber Accident Case End Up At Trial?
Most attorneys prefer to avoid bringing cases to court, as trials can be costly, and the results are unpredictable. Out-of-court settlements are typically the resolution in these cases. In certain cases, however, trials may lead to compensation amounts that exceed those obtained through settlements; thus, trials are not always less favorable outcomes. How Long Does It Take To Resolve An Uber Accident Case?
The specifics of your case shall determine the duration needed to settle an accident claim. Instances concerning minor Uber accidents get resolved within six to twelve months on average. However, more complex situations may continue for several years.
